Job Description
The Senior Human Resource Officer performs and has responsibility for a wide range of Human Resource related duties at the professional level in all of the functional human resource areas including administration, reporting, employee engagement, digital processes and the effective use of human resource information systems to support operational efficiency and informed decision-making.
Key and Critical Responsibilities
<ul><li>Responsible for the Company's recruitment and selection function, inclusive of being a member of interview panels when required. <ul><li>Ensures Job Descriptions are appropriately reviewed, updated and disseminated to employees. </li><li>Develops Annual Company-wide Training Plan. </li><li>Administers the Performance Management System. </li><li>Conducts Exit Interviews and analyzes data making appropriate recommendations to the Manager, HRCS for corrective action and continuous improvement. </li><li>Maintains personnel databases, inclusive of Company's establishment figures, ensuring accuracy of data at all times. </li><li>Assists with the orientation of new employees when required. </li><li>Assists with the development of reports, policies and procedures when required. </li><li>Assists with the implementation of approved Policies and Procedures ensuring appropriate tracking mechanisms are applied. </li><li>Develops, administers and monitors digital forms and related tools to support HR processes, data collection and workflow efficiency. </li><li>Assists with the design, coordination and administration of employee surveys, feedback tools and other staff engagement initiatives. </li><li>Compiles, analyses and presents survey results and employee feedback data and makes recommendations to Manager, HRCS for improvement initiatives. </li><li>Assists with the digitalisation and continuous improvement of human resource processes, forms, records and workflows to improve efficiency, tracking and service delivery. </li><li>Maintains and utilises the Company's human resource information system, ensuring accurate data entry, updates, records management and reporting. </li><li>Provides support and guidance to employees in the use of human resource related digital tools, forms and systems when required. </li><li>Maintains effective working relationships with employees in related operational areas and with members of the general public. </li><li>Ensures compliance with Occupational Safety and Health Regulations. </li><li>Performs any other duties as may be required to successfully achieve this job function.</li></ul></li></ul>
